Placing water by Sri Guru Granth sahib ji has its benefits.  However I would not say it is Amrit.  Amrit is only given by the Punj Pyare today.  This blessing was given to the Punj Pyare by Guru Gobind Singh Sahib ji.  There are many people claiming they give Amrit but all these are not Amrit.

Placing water should have no effect. it is not a sin to have water there to drink or something but if you are doing it for some magical powers or manmat bonuses then it is false ritual/ superstition.

Anti panthic forces keep making up stuff about how it stores 'magical' energy, if that were true just leave a tank full of water next to speaker which is reading sri guru granth sahib and use that water for everything....
